Spa with style: Waldorf Astoria Edinburgh and Harvey Nichols launch luxury spa and private shopping package
POSTED 14 Dec 2022 . BY Megan Whitby
Harvey Nichols stylists curate a selection of designer pieces based on the guest's preferences Credit: Shutterstock/PeopleImages.com - Yuri A
Urban Scottish hotel Waldorf Astoria Edinburgh has launched a new wellness package in partnership with luxury department store Harvey Nichols, Edinburgh.

The experience is available to guests staying in one of the hotel’s suites and includes a curated wellness treatment by either 111Skin or Ground Wellbeing, in addition to a two-hour private shopping experience with the stylist team from Harvey Nichols in the comfort of guests' rooms.

Designed to relax and rejuvenate both mind and body – while refreshing guests’ wardrobes – the Suite, Spa & Style package has a starting cost of £205 (US$251, €238) per person.

The experience begins with an introductory call pre-arrival with the Private Shopping team at Harvey Nichols to discuss guests' personal preferences, from preferred brands and colour palettes to sizes and styles.

Once arrived and settled into their suite, guests receive a glass of bubbles and a selection of sweet treats, while a stylist showcases a curated edit of designer pieces.

Following this, guests travel to the five-treatment-room spa and pick their luxury treatment of choice. Two package tiers are available to choose from, depending on whether guests would like an hour-and-a-half or a two-hour spa treatment.

The first menu includes the following 60-minute experiences: the Sleep Ritual massage by Ground Wellbeing or the Signature Harley Street Facial by 111Skin to repair irritated skin.

Alternatively, guests can opt for longer treatments on the tier two menu. They can choose between 111Skin’s Rose Gold Radiance Facial & Rose Radiance Body Treatment or the Tar Liom ritual by Ground Wellbeing, a signature Celtic treatment which involves a scrub, a hot oil massage, a scalp and foot massage and finally a body wrap.
